/**
* Linkify take a piece of text and a regular expression and turns all of the
* regex matches in the text into clickable links. This is particularly
- * useful for matching things like email addresses, web urls, etc. and making
+ * useful for matching things like email addresses, web URLs, etc. and making
* them actionable.
*
- * Alone with the pattern that is to be matched, a url scheme prefix is also
+ * Alone with the pattern that is to be matched, a URL scheme prefix is also
* required. Any pattern match that does not begin with the supplied scheme
- * will have the scheme prepended to the matched text when the clickable url
- * is created. For instance, if you are matching web urls you would supply
- * the scheme <code>http://</code>. If the pattern matches example.com, which
- * does not have a url scheme prefix, the supplied scheme will be prepended to
- * create <code>http://example.com</code> when the clickable url link is
+ * will have the scheme prepended to the matched text when the clickable URL
+ * is created. For instance, if you are matching web URLs you would supply
+ * the scheme <code>http://</code>. If the pattern matches example.com, which
+ * does not have a URL scheme prefix, the supplied scheme will be prepended to
+ * create <code>http://example.com</code> when the clickable URL link is
* created.
*/
